Firstly, let’s understand what triggers a blocked drain. Whether it’s fats, oils, hair, foreign objects, or an array of other build-ups over time, blocked drains can eventually cause significant disruptions if undetected or untreated. In Bristol, instances of blocked drains are common due to the age and construction of some local buildings. The process of drain unblocking in Bristol typically entails several specific steps. Professionals begin by undertaking a thorough inspection to identify the source of the clog. This inspection starts with a visual check, but often the blockage is not readily visible or accessible. If this is the case, specialists will employ a modern drain camera via a flexible rod into the pipe, giving them a clear, real-time visual of what’s happening inside the drain unblocking bristol drain.
Next, once the blockage is located, experts will assess the severity of the blockage and the appropriate course of action. A minor blockage may be tackled with manual rodding, using a flexible metal rod to push through and dislodge the obstruction. As simple as it may sound, this method requires finesse and precision to avoid causing damage to the pipe itself, which is why it is recommended to leave it to experienced professionals.
If the drain blockage is severe or in a challenging location, a more advanced technique called high-pressure water jetting is used. This involves blasting water at a high pressure down the pipe to flush out the obstruction, breaking it down to smaller pieces that can easily flow through the drainage system. Because of its power and effectiveness, this method can potentially save costs of replacing the whole pipe and minimises disruption to households or businesses.
In scenarios where blockage persists after these initial steps, it may indicate a deeper problem that requires excavation and pipe replacement. Thanks to using cameras during the initial inspection, experts can pinpoint the exact location of the problem to keep the excavation limited. The damaged pipe will then be replaced and reconnected to the existing drainage system.
However, the drain unblocking process doesn’t end at merely fixing the issue. To prevent future blockages, professionals also offer helpful advice and preventive measures. These can vary from simple habits like avoiding disposing of inappropriate things down the drain to periodic drain cleaning and maintenance services.
